Cultural Facts:

  1. Personal Struggle: Leadbelly spent years in Texas and Louisiana prisons, where music became both survival tool and the thing that eventually carried his name outside the walls.
  2. Legal Trouble: His prison releases became part of the myth, with songs, petitions, and folklorist attention all feeding the story of a dangerous man turned folk source.
  3. Scene Ecology: Alan Lomax’s recordings helped move Leadbelly from regional Black folk tradition into the Library of Congress and the later folk revival canon.
